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4

The NM_145168.3(SDR42E1):c.1064A>G(p.His355Arg) variant causes a missense change. The variant allele was found at a frequency of 0.00000743 in 1,614,120 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
SDR42E1 (HGNC:29834): (short chain dehydrogenase/reductase family 42E, member 1) Predicted to enable oxidoreductase activity, acting on the CH-OH group of donors, NAD or NADP as acceptor. Predicted to be involved in steroid biosynthetic process. Predicted to be integral component of membrane. [provided by Alliance of Genome Resources, Apr 2022]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sMay 01, 2022The c.1064A>G (p.H355R) alteration is located in exon 3 (coding exon 2) of the SDR42E1 gene. This alteration results from a A to G substitution at nucleotide position 1064, causing the histidine (H) at amino acid position 355 to be replaced by an arginine (R).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
